Sorry, this job is no longer accepting applications. See below for more jobs that match what you’re looking for!

Software Development Engineer, Finance Technology

Expired Job

Remitly Seattle , WA 98113

Posted 1 week ago

At Remitly, we're helping people send over $4 billion around the globe motivated by our mission to deliver on our promise to immigrants sending money across the world.

As a Software Development Engineer at Remitly, you are a builder and a leader, responsible for pursuing complex technical and customer problems and creating extraordinary products backed by great systems. We use cutting edge languages, tools, and frameworks to build applications and services on top of a scalable cloud architecture. Our startup work environment is fast-paced, passionate and growing quickly.

Successful engineers use their experience to research and evaluate technical options, then apply standard methodologies and design patterns to architect, build, and maintain high quality systems. They work across teams to define and articulate the true technical requirements underlying feature requests, and design with an eye for simultaneously accomplishing company goals, improving existing systems, and reducing technical debt. They are also acutely aware that software isn't complete after shipping, instead designing for stability, monitoring, and maintenance over time to deliver quality software while shooting for stars; they create systems that can evolve but last for years. More than just building, engineers also mentor, evangelize engineering practices, and continuously inspire technical excellence across the company.

Part of Finance Engineering Team:

  • You will be building an accurate, immutable, scalable and resilient financial tracking system.

  • You will be building a scalable reconciling platform via integrating with diverse bank APIs around the globe to provide accurate view of financials.

  • Integrating online machine learning and predictive analytics models with our transactional systems to improve treasury operations.

Requirements:

  • A BS/MS in Computer Science or equivalent professional experience.

  • 5+ years of experience as a software developer.

  • A deep understanding of software development practices, system design, software design patterns, and algorithms.

  • Expertise in one or more general purpose languages like Java, Go, PHP, JavaScript,Python, or Ruby.

  • Strong ability to mentor and influence other engineers.

  • Excellent verbal and written interpersonal skills.

  • Experience defining and influencing technical designs and processes across a team.

Who we are:

Remitly is a group of passionate people working to make international payments easier and more clear on both the web and mobile devices. We are seeking team members to join us that want to make a difference and change an industry. We pride ourselves on aiming high and delivering results, data being at the heart of everything we do, and inspiring team to own business decisions and outcomes. Does this sound like the place for you? Join us!

Remitly is an Equal Opportunity Employer. Individuals seeking employment at Remitly are considered without regard to race, color, religion, national origin, age, sex, marital status, ancestry, physical or mental disability, veteran status, or sexual orientation.

Remitly is an E-Verify Employer


See if you are a match!

See how well your resume matches up to this job - upload your resume now.

Find your dream job anywhere
with the LiveCareer app.
Download the
LiveCareer app and find
your dream job anywhere
lc_ad

Boost your job search productivity with our
free Chrome Extension!

lc_apply_tool GET EXTENSION

Similar Jobs

Want to see jobs matched to your resume? Upload One Now! Remove
Payments Software Development Engineer In Test (Sdet) Starbucks Technology Seattle WA

Starbucks

Posted 2 weeks ago

VIEW JOBS 9/5/2018 12:00:00 AM 2018-12-04T00:00 Job Summary and Mission Would you like to work on one of the largest eCommerce platforms in the industry, with millions of daily transactions serving worldwide customers for their morning coffee? Do you have a passion for well-engineered APIs and software Quality? Then come join our Starbucks digital platform's payment & anti-fraud team! This position contributes to Starbucks success by designing, developing, and sustaining automated test processes, practices, methods, tools and controls in support of application and system requirement, development and test activities throughout the software development and sustainment lifecycles. Supervises other software development engineers in test to develop simple to complex test automation scripts. Recommends quality improvements to automation requirements, development, and execution, and facilitates the development and implementation of test automation frameworks. Provides oversight and guidance to analysts, developers and testers in the creation and implementation of test automation processes, methods and tools. Models and acts in accordance with Starbucks guiding principles. Summary of Key Responsibilities Responsibilities and essential job functions include but are not limited to the following: * Develops, maintains, and executes automated test scripts. * Advances and improves automation framework design features and implements automated test suites and test cases within that framework. * Recommends quality improvements to automation requirements, design, build, and execution, and then assists in the development and implementation of enhancements. * Participates in tool analysis, creates proof of concept models, and makes recommendations to support the tools selection process. * Establishes the criteria and participates in evaluation on whether features and functions will be automated. * Provides oversight to quality assurance analysts and engineers, developers, and testers on test automation and performance test activities, and then accurately monitors and communicates test execution results. * Consolidates, analyses, and debugs automated test scripts. * Creates and manufactures test data needed for execution or database population. * Follows coding and design standards and provides suggestions on improvements. * Participates in the continual maintenance of code base and refactoring. Summary of Experience * 5 years of experience designing and developing test automation frameworks with demonstrated programming languages and script development skills * Bachelor's degree with coursework in Computer Science, Information Systems, Informatics, or a related field or degree equivalent; and/or work experience in Software Development Quality Assurance Required Knowledge, Skills and Abilities * Strong organization and planning skills * Ability to communicate clearly and concisely, both verbally and in writing * Strong analytical and problem-solving abilities * Ability to implement algorithms and design patterns * Team player who exhibits effective interpersonal skills with a collaborative style and exceptional business savvy * Ability to handle numerous concurrent activities under time constraints and effectively prioritize and execute assignments in a highly dynamic environment * Demonstrated collaboration on diverse teams including project managers, business and systems analysts, technicians and developers related to quality assurance roles and responsibilities * Ability to improve individual job skills through training, self-research and self-study * Knowledge of application software development life cycle concepts, lean and agile best practices, environment and configuration management, test management methodologies and processes * Knowledge of testing best practices and approaches for custom developed and consumer off-the-shelf packaged applications * Ability to design and develop test automation scripts with demonstrated language and script development skills with strong coding knowledge, and experience in object oriented development programming * Experience developing or working with commercial or open source automation tools and frameworks * Demonstrate knowledge using version control and defect tracking methods, including an understanding of associated tools * Experience with quality assurance testing related to release management * Basic understanding of Cloud computing services including Software as a Service (SaaS), Platform as a Service (PaaS), and Infrastructure as a Service (IaaS) * General understanding of application and system architecture concepts including service-oriented architecture (SOA) * Knowledge of mobile digital technologies related to testing * Basic understanding of Infrastructure technologies including operating systems, networks, servers, and databases * Basic understanding of project management functions and related tools Starbucks and its brands are an equal opportunity employer of all qualified individuals, including minorities, women, veterans & individuals with disabilities. Starbucks will consider for employment qualified applicants with criminal histories in a manner consistent with all federal, state, and local ordinances. Starbucks Seattle WA

Software Development Engineer, Finance Technology

Expired Job

Remitly